This is GREAT NEWS!! Here's a URL for others who end up on this page like I did when searching for information on this to check on the status: https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/microsoft-365/roadmap?filters=&searchterms=85688.
Now let's just hope that MS can keep to this schedule. For us, like for other posts here, this is the critical deficiency with Planner. We can't use it for software development if we can't quickly and easily paste screen shots into comments or initial task items. The way this works in Jira, Trello, or even Microsoft's own Teams Chat/Posts is perfect. Need to be able to paste images, not save them to a file, then navigate to the file to attach them. That turns a 1 second process into about a minute, which is long enough to destroy productivity and keep the team from being willing to use Planner, which in turn undermines interest in Teams too (even though Teams supports this capability in its own Chat windows, if we have to use Jira or Trello for project work, then Teams is much less attractive as a platform).
So glad it looks like this is finally coming to Planner too.
